The Kardar-Parisi-Zhang equation as scaling limit of weakly asymmetric interacting Brownian motions
Published 7 Jun 2016 in math.PR, math-ph, math.AP, and math.MP | (1606.02331v1)
Abstract: We consider a system of infinitely many interacting Brownian motions that models the height of a one-dimensional interface between two bulk phases. We prove that the large scale fluctuations of the system are well approximated by the solution to the KPZ equation provided the microscopic interaction is weakly asymmetric. The proof is based on the martingale solutions of Goncalves and Jara and the corresponding uniqueness result of Gubinelli and Perkowski.
